Output 512e7c4c51e7afa7721718a52bf0bc82d1f81cf0a4e4f55be1c45975c6522cff:3

value
25821141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6944ba4b9ead3acd0bbed0f0f81c91eeb534d470 OP_EQUAL
address
MHVmWrhzuMXRpvUai7XkXLNWjzHXHaBjhZ
transaction
512e7c4c51e7afa7721718a52bf0bc82d1f81cf0a4e4f55be1c45975c6522cff
spent
true